What is Claude IPC MCP?

Claude IPC MCP is a model context protocol for inter-process communication (IPC) between CLI (Command Line Interface) artificial intelligence assistants. It allows natural language communication between AI agents, enabling cross-platform, secure, and persistent message passing.

How to use Claude IPC MCP?

You can start using it by setting a shared secret and registering AI instances. Users can interact with other AIs through natural language commands, such as sending messages and checking messages.

Applicable scenarios

It is suitable for development environments that require the collaboration of multiple AI assistants, such as code review, problem-solving, and task assignment scenarios.

Main features

Natural language commands
Users can complete operations such as registration and sending messages by simply entering natural language commands.
Future messages
You can send messages to AIs that do not yet exist, and they will be automatically received after the AI is registered.
SQLite persistence
Use the SQLite database to store messages, ensuring that data is not lost after the server restarts.
Real-time renaming
You can change the identity of an AI at runtime, and messages will be automatically forwarded.
Large message handling
Messages larger than 10KB will be automatically converted to file storage.
Cross-platform compatibility
Supports integration with multiple AI platforms such as Claude Code, Windsurf, and Gemini.
24/7 operation
The server runs around the clock, with crash recovery and message persistence functions.
Automatic checking
You can set up automatic periodic checks for new messages.
Session security
Protect message security through authentication tokens.
UV package management
Use UV for fast and modern Python dependency management.

Limitations
Requires setting a shared secret, which may be slightly complicated for first-time use
Only applicable to AI platforms that support Python execution
Some advanced features require configuration and maintenance
